From 5ee8aa689780f2c19702fe3768a3103b9c07d72e Mon Sep 17 00:00:00 2001 From: Xin Long Date: Tue, 20 Jun 2017 16:05:11 +0800 Subject: [PATCH] sctp: handle errors when updating asoc It's a bad thing not to handle errors when updating asoc. The memory allocation failure in any of the functions called in sctp_assoc_update() would cause sctp to work unexpectedly. This patch is to fix it by aborting the asoc and reporting the error when any of these functions fails.
